What operating expenses mean
Operating expenses are the recurring costs of running a company’s business beyond the direct costs used to calculate gross profit. They commonly include selling, general and administrative expenses, research and development, and other operating costs.
SEC-reported and calculated operating expenses
TickerStat uses operating expenses reported in company SEC filings when available. When a separate total is unavailable, it calculates operating expenses as aligned gross profit minus operating income for the same fiscal period. Fiscal periods can differ from calendar years, so exact period-end dates are included.
